Today’s column is about spelling, a topic that has been much on the minds of folks here at your East Valley Paragraph Factory. More precisely, the topic is “Spell Check,’’ one of the modern conveniences ushered in by the Computer Age.

While there are a lot of conveniences that I could just as soon live without, I do not include Spell Check among them. Like most modern-day Sentence Engineers, I have come to rely on this feature heavily, and it has been a great asset in my bid to appease the retired English teachers who scrutinize my efforts with red ink pen in hands and a scowl on their faces.

In the days before Spell Check, writers would have to consult the dictionary for the proper spelling of words they weren’t sure about. The problem there is that you had to know a word was spelled wrong before you were compelled to look it up, a troublesome paradox indeed.
